There aren’t many artists I’ve worked with in the DMV who paint Bison and Steer Cattle. Kathy Winkler developed a love for these large animals as a child growing up in Texas, and I’ve had the great pleasure of documenting her work over the past 20 years, while getting to know her wonderful family and friends. “I have felt a connection with all animals throughout my life.. my objective in painting is to enable the viewer to feel the animals emotion.” Before making art full time, Kathy was a program engineering manager for US Naval combat warfare systems. @kathy09021942 #virginiaartists #southwestart #animalart #representationalart

“If That Makes Sense” is the current MFA candidate’s exhibit at the Katzen. Musician/artist Rob Balsewich’s installation is called MID-E, where he “constructs custom instruments from reclaimed second hand and locally sourced materials. Viewers of this installation become participants as they use provided artist-made drumsticks to experiment musically, transcending the artworks meaning from the objects themselves to the collective experiment they facilitate.” Other artists include: Sarah Bell Wilson, Michael Dodson, Julia Fouser, Kelvin He Hao Low, Ryan Kennedy, Lexi Moser, Austin Remetta and Brent Spencer. Along with “Out of Green Mansions” featuring the woodblock prints by Sandy Walker. Up until mid May. @auartsdc @aumuseum_katzen #recycledart #printmakingart #homemadeinstruments #studentartists

Another provocative exhibit offered by the Smith Center for Healing and the Arts.. “The Struggle Continues” features work from Tim Davis’ Power Room series. “Using repurposed drawers and cabinets, he constructs symbolic containers holding the layered truths of housing inequality, discrimination, racism, mass incarceration, migration and other defining issues shaping America.” When perceived within the glare of current times it packs an additional punch. Up until June 5th. @smithcenterdc #humanrights #healingartist #mixedmedia #truthtelling
